Now the next question. I have XP pro, 2.8g processor, 1g of memory and
quicktime, volume control, usb removal, realtek audio manager, norton, and a
logitech itouch program loading on the task bar. When it boots up sometimes
all of these show up, sometimes some of them, sometimes none of them. What's
happening? Thanks again.
 
Hi,

Icons are missing or disappear, reappear: This happens for most Auto-Logon
users.

Methods/workarounds: Log off and Log back on, password protect your account
or disable SSDP and uPNP Services.
